An exciting opportunity has arisen for a Senior RF Engineer to join a specialist UK electronics company working on advanced RF and microwave systems. The company designs, develops, and delivers high-performance RF solutions across multiple industries, including defence, aerospace, and communications.
This role is ideal for a technically skilled engineer with hands-on experience in RF design, testing, and integration who thrives in a collaborative, high-precision engineering environment.
Main Responsibilities:- Design, analyse, and optimise RF circuits and subsystems across microwave frequency bands (1GHz–18GHz).
- Develop and implement low-noise amplifiers (LNAs), power amplifiers (PAs), mixers, filters, oscillators, and synthesizers.
- Conduct RF system architecture and front-end design, balancing performance, cost, power, and size.
- Execute RF simulation, modelling, and statistical analysis using industry-standard tools (Keysight ADS, AWR Microwave Office, CST, HFSS).
- Perform RF testing and validation using spectrum analysers, VNAs, signal generators, power meters, and noise figure analysers.
- Troubleshoot RF issues at component, PCB, and system level and correlate lab measurements with simulations.
- Collaborate with PCB layout engineers to ensure controlled impedance, grounding, shielding, and overall RF performance.
- Support EMC, EMI, and regulatory compliance testing and certification activities.
- Mentor junior RF engineers and contribute to technical design reviews, reports, and customer documentation.
